The GE Series 90-70 (IC697 prefix) is GE Automation & Controls' rack-based programmable logic controller platform, deployed across heavy industrial sectors including petrochemical refineries, nuclear power generation, pulp and paper mills, and offshore oil & gas facilities. First introduced in the late 1980s, the Series 90-70 established itself as a high-density, high-throughput PLC architecture capable of handling complex ladder logic, function block diagrams, and structured text programs under IEC 61131-3. Its VME-based backplane architecture supports up to 21 slots per rack, enabling large-scale I/O configurations that remain in active service at thousands of global installations. The IC697CPU788 is a 32-bit CPU module within this platform, executing user programs at high speed with expanded memory capacity relative to earlier CPU variants in the same family.
The Series 90-70 architecture progressed through several CPU generations, each addressing processing speed, memory capacity, and communication capability constraints of its era. The earliest CPUs — IC697CPU731 and IC697CPU771 — operated with limited user memory (32KB–128KB) and single-task execution models. The mid-generation IC697CPU772 and IC697CPU781 introduced expanded RAM and faster scan cycle performance. The IC697CPU788 and IC697CPU789 represent the high-end tier of the Series 90-70 CPU range, offering 512KB to 1MB of user memory, floating-point math coprocessor support, and compatibility with the full IC697 I/O module library.
The platform's VME backplane (IC697CHS750, IC697CHS782, IC697CHS790) remained consistent across generations, ensuring backward compatibility for I/O modules. However, CPU firmware versions must be matched to the Logicmaster 90-70 or Proficy Machine Edition programming software version in use. Mixing incompatible firmware and software versions is a documented source of configuration faults in legacy installations. The Series 90-70 has been in the mature/end-of-life phase since the mid-2010s, with GE (now part of Emerson) having transitioned customers toward the PACSystems RX7i platform, which uses the same VME mechanical form factor but a different CPU and backplane architecture.
